Description
Sandstone Cenotaph with a Celtic cross carved in low relief on the face and a half-scale bronze figure of 'Victory' at the front of the monument. The WW1 names are in Lead lettering on the faces of the cenotaph. The WW2 names are on stone tablets - 4 columns on each tablet. The whole sits on a platform raised by 5 steps and is protected by wrought iron fencing with an entrance gate.
